Chiefs establish initial 53-man roster

KANSAS CITY, Mo. – The Chiefs on Saturday made 22 transactions to trim the roster to meet the NFL-mandated 53-man roster deadline.

The Chiefs waived 17 players, placed quarterback Tyler Bray (ankle, knee) and wide receiver Kyle Williams (shoulder) on injured reserve, designated defensive end Mike Catapano (illness) to the reserve/non-football injury list and moved wide receiver Dwayne Bowe and right tackle Donald Stephenson to the reserve/suspended list.

“As a collective football operation,” general manager John Dorsey said in a released statement, “coaches and scouts have held numerous discussions on each player during the evaluation process.

“We had excellent competition at every position and that’s a great thing, but today we had to make some difficult decisions to narrow our roster to 53. We appreciate all the time and effort these young men put in for us and wish them all the best.”

The players waived Saturday:

• Safety Jonathon Amaya
• Safety Malcolm Bronson
• Fullback Jordan Campbell
• Defensive lineman Dominique Hamilton
• Wide receiver Mark Harrison
• Guard Ricky Henry
• Linebacker Alonzo Highsmith
• Linebacker Nico Johnson
• Defensive tackle Kyle Love
• Cornerback Justin Rogers
• Defensive lineman Kona Schwenke
• Kicker Ryan Succop
• Linebacker Devan Walker
• Offensive lineman J’Marcus Webb
• Cornerback DeMarcus Van Dyke
• Running back Charcandrick West
• Wide receiver Fred Williams

TRANSACTIONS

The Chiefs placed quarterback Tyler Bray and wide receiver Kyle Williams on injured reserve. Bray sustained ankle and knee injuries during the preseason finale, while Williams suffered a shoulder injury in the preseason finale.

The Chiefs placed defensive end Mike Catapano on the reserve non-football injury list, meaning the second-year pro is not expected to return this season and won’t count against the roster. Catapano battled an illness that caused him to miss nine training camp practices in St. Joseph, Mo., four practices in Kansas City and all preseason games.

The Chiefs moved wide receiver Dwayne Bowe and right tackle Donald Stephenson to the reserve/suspended list. Bowe will serve a one-game suspension for violating the league’s policy on substance abuse, while Stephenson serves a four-game suspension for violating the league’s policy on performance enhancing substances.

The Chiefs have roster exemptions for Bowe and Stephenson, as both don’t count against the 53-man roster. The team, however, will need to make roster moves to accommodate their respective return.

OTHER ITEMS 

The Chiefs haven’t identified a player as reserve/injured with “designated to return,” but may do so on Sept. 2. Inside linebacker Joe Mays, who recently underwent wrist surgery to repair ligament damage, is a prime candidate.

The Chiefs can establish the 10-man practice squad starting at noon ET.

DEPTH CHART

The below chart is based on subtractions of recent transactions and on the fourth preseason depth chart. The Chiefs will release the first regular season depth chart in the coming days for the season opener.

 OFFENSE

Wide receiver (4)
“X” or split end
Donnie Avery, A.J. Jenkins, Albert Wilson, Frankie Hammond Jr.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Avery, Jenkins and Chad Hall, who was claimed off waivers from the San Francisco 49ers on Sept. 1, 2013.

Left tackle (1) Eric Fisher

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Branden Albert and Donald Stephenson. Albert left via free agency in March.

Left guard (4) Jeff Allen, Jeff Linkenbach, Laurent Duvernay-Tardif, Mike McGlynn

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with just Allen at left guard.

Center (2) Rodney Hudson, Eric Kush

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Hudson and Kush.

Right guard (1) Zach Fulton

The Chiefs have Jeff Linkenbach, who can play both sides of the offensive line.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Jon Asamoah, who left via free agency in March.

Right tackle (1) Ryan Harris

The Chiefs have a roster exemption while Donald Stephenson serves a four-game suspension. The Chiefs are expected to move left guard to right tackle.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Eric Fisher and Geoff Schwartz. Fisher moved to left tackle during the offseason. Schwartz, one of the team’s  swing offensive linemen in 2013, left via free agency in March.

Tight end (4) Anthony Fasano, Travis Kelce, Demetrius Harris, Richard Gordon

All four tight ends made the initial cuts.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Fasano, Kelce and Sean McGrath, who retired in late July.

Wide receiver (1)
“Z” or flanker
Junior Hemingway

The Chiefs have a roster exemption during Dwayne Bowe’s one-game suspension to start the regular season. Kyle Williams (shoulder) was placed on injured reserve.

Frankie Hammond Jr. projects as the starter at the Z position for the regular season opener.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Bowe, Hemingway and Dexter McCluster.

Quarterback (3) Alex Smith, Chase Daniel, Aaron Murray

The Chiefs placed quarterback Tyler Bray (ankle, knee) on injured reserve.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Smith, Daniel and Bray.

Running back (5) Jamaal Charles, Knile Davis, De’Anthony Thomas, Cyrus Gray, Joe McKnight

The Chiefs kept five running backs after waiving rookie Charcandrick West.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s entered the 2013 season with Charles, Davis and Gray.

Fullback (1)  Anthony Sherman

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Sherman.

DEFENSE

Left defensive end (2) Allen Bailey, Jaye Howard

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Tyson Jackson, Allen Bailey and Mike Catapano.

Nose tackle (2) Dontari Poe, Vance Walker

The Chiefs waived Kyle Love, who came on the final three preseason games with nine tackles (six solo) and a sack.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Poe and Howard.

Right defensive end (1) Mike DeVito

The Chiefs placed Mike Catapano (illness) on the reserve non-football injury list, meaning he’s not expected to return this season or count against the roster.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with DeVito and Anthony Toribio.

Left outside linebacker (3) Justin Houston, Frank Zombo, Josh Martin

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Houston, Zombo and Martin.

Left inside linebacker (2) Joe Mays, Josh Mauga

Mauga’s emergence made Nico Johnson, last season’s fourth-round draft pick, expendable. The Chiefs haven’t identified a player for injured reserve/designated to return, but Mays (wrist) makes sense.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Akeem Jordan and Johnson.

Right inside linebacker (2) Derrick Johnson, James-Michael Johnson

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with both Johnsons.

Right outside linebacker (2) Tamba Hali, Dee Ford

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Hali and Dezman Moses.

Left cornerback (3) Marcus Cooper, Chris Owens, Phillip Gaines

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Brandon Flowers and Cooper.

Right cornerback (2) Ron Parker, Sean Smith

DeMarcus Van Dyke was in the running for a roster spot before suffering a high ankle sprain in the preseason finale. He was waived/injured, meaning Van Dyke will go to injured reserve if he clears waivers.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Smith, Parker and Dunta Robinson.

Strong safety (2) Eric Berry, Daniel Sorensen

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Berry and Quintin Demps.

Free safety (2) Husain Abdullah, Kelcie McCray

The waiving of Malcolm Bronson was a surprise, but the acquisition of McCray via trade with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ers made Bronson expendable.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s started the season with Abdullah, Kendrick Lewis and Commings, who was then placed on injured reserve with a designation to return.

SPECIALISTS

Punter (1) Dustin Colquitt

2013 REFERENCE POINT: This is Colquitt’s job.

Kicker (1) Cairo Santos

Santos edged veteran Ryan Succop, the team’s seventh-round pick of the 2009 NFL Draft. Succop shouldn’t be out of work for long.

2013 REFERENCE POINT: Succop was the lone place kicker on the roster.

Long snapper (1) Thomas Gafford

2013 REFERENCE POINT: Gafford was the long snapper with tight end Sean McGrath as his backup.

Punt returner (2) De’Anthony Thomas, Frankie Hammond

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s entered the season with Dexter McCluster and Quintin Demps, both of whom left via free agency in March.

Kick returner (3) Knile Davis, Albert Wilson, De’Anthony Thomas, Frankie Hammond

2013 REFERENCE POINT: The Chiefs entered the season with Quintin Demps, Dexter McCluster and Knile Davis.
